Quick Definition
pure
Strong's Definition
beloved; also pure, empty
Derivation: from H1305 (בָּרַר) (in its various senses);
KJV Usage: choice, clean, clear, pure.
TWOT Reference: 288a
Outline of Biblical Usage
adj
1) pure, clear, sincere
2) clean, empty
adv
3) purely
